Vern Falby

Dr. Vern Falby is retired from the Music Theory Faculty of the Peabody Conservatory at Johns Hopkins University.

Dr. Falby encourages listeners to consciously notice the multi-aspectual, layered aural design of entire pieces, with the ultimate goal of enhancing music making and its effect on audiences. He has pursued this work for over thirty years in his project Thinking by Ear: Strategies for Music Making, working with students, in professional schools of music, and in private practice. The goal is to transform our experience of music, from series of notes in a row, into pieces that move audiences: unfolding processes to actively follow, learn and learn from, recreate or create anew.
